Output e80b69c461c0241450837dd61f6cccfab272261f2f607645233766270d378852:17

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5917724ca66444015a2b040ca616a498c84a0ac21c76f3ace6fdb3325160fae3
address
bc1ptythyn9xv3zqzk3tqsx2v94ynryy5zkzr3m08t8xlkeny5tqlt3s8snyuf
transaction
e80b69c461c0241450837dd61f6cccfab272261f2f607645233766270d378852
spent
true